Ex HTC executives which include Michael Coombes, HTC’s former Head of Sales and James Atkins, former HTC’s head of marketing in UK and Ireland have sent shock-waves through-out the mobile phone markets with the revelation of a new and exciting smartphone; “a new brand that really stands out in the mobile space” called Kazam.


Kazam will have its global headquarters in London, with a range of other smartphones coming out in the later part of 2013. An effective sales and marketing network across Europe is also assured.

CEO of Kazam, Michael Coombes said that the company’s “dynamic structure and focus on local markets means we can react quickly to the ever evolving and diverging needs of today’s consumer”. - See more at: http://www.thatnaijablog.com/2013/06/kazam-smartphones-to-launch-in-2013.html
